9 / 57 page ![]() AN3392 Application information Doc ID 018749 Rev 1 9/57 2 Application information A step-up (or boost) converter is a switching DC-DC converter able to generate an output voltage higher than the input voltage. Figure 5. Step-up converter single-ended architecture The switching element (Sw) is typically driven by a fixed-frequency rectangular waveform generated by a PWM controller. When Sw is closed (Ton), the inductor stores energy and its current increases with a slope depending on the voltage across the inductor and its inductance value. During this time the output voltage is sustained by Cout and the diode doesn’t allow any charge transfer from output to input stages. When Sw is open (Toff) the current in the inductor flows toward the output until the voltage on node “A” is higher than the output voltage. During this phase the current in the inductor decreases while the output voltage increases. Figure 6 shows the behavior of the current on the inductor. Figure 6.
